Teams’ Creative Utilization of Defensive Tackles

Teams often employ defensive tackles in creative ways to disrupt opposing offenses and increase their effectiveness.

  • Using Defensive Tackles as Pass Rush Specialists: Some teams deploy their defensive tackles as pass rush specialists, utilizing their exceptional skills to rush the quarterback and disrupt the opponent’s offense.
    This strategy, often employed by the Los Angeles Rams with Aaron Donald, creates mismatches and forces opponents to account for the defensive tackle’s rushing prowess.
  • Blitzing from the Defensive Tackle Position: Coaches frequently use defensive tackles as part of their blitz packages, sending them from their defensive line position to pressure the quarterback.
    This strategy, such as the Pittsburgh Steelers’ use of Cam Heyward, can create confusion and disrupt the opponent’s offense, forcing errors and turnovers.

Defensive tackles are not just blockers; they can also be game-changers with their pass rush skills and versatility, making them a crucial element in a team’s defense.
